About SEMOVIS mission
Very-high-resolution Earth observation payload combining sub-meter VIS/NIR imaging and high-resolution SWIR.
The SEMOViS project is part of ESA’s InCubed programme and is led by Marble Imaging with Scanway as subcontractor.
It aims to develop a very-high-resolution (VHR) optical payload for a future satellite constellation. The first satellite launch is planned for Q1 2026. The two-year project includes full development, integration, and commissioning of the payload.

SOP 450
Scanway Optical Payload
The instrument features a sub-meter resolution imager operating in the visible and near-infrared (VIS/NIR) bands, combined with a high-resolution short-wave infrared (SWIR) channel. It is designed to deliver very-high-resolution data for commercial Earth observation applications.
GSD
0,8 m
OBSERVED AREA
10,2 x 7,64 km
ENVELOPE
500 x 500 x 700
APERTURE
450 mm
